Sherpa 452cc Engine: The Generational Leap
The previous Himalayan used a carbureted 411cc engine with technology from the 80s. The new 450 arrives with a completely new 452cc DOHC engine with electronic fuel injection, liquid cooling, and 40 hp. It is a smoother, more efficient (60 mpg), and much more refined engine. The 40 Nm of torque arrives at just 5,500 rpm — perfect for off-road riding at low speeds where control is key.
Over-the-Air Updates
Royal Enfield implemented OTA (Over-the-Air) updates in the Himalayan 450, like Tesla in electric cars. Your bike can improve over time without going to the shop: new features, calibration improvements, and software bug fixes via Wi-Fi.
Who is the 2024 Himalayan 450 for?
For budget-conscious adventurers, beginners who want to start with a bike that allows off-road exploration, and urbanites who want to escape on weekends without compromising their budget.
✓ Pros
- •Unbeatable price for its features
- •TFT screen with Google Maps navigation
- •Over-the-Air updates
- •Smooth and efficient Sherpa DOHC engine
- •200mm suspension ready for real off-road
✗ Cons
- •40hp limits performance on highway at full load
- •Limited service network in some countries
- •No traction control or cornering ABS
Final verdict
The Himalayan 450 is the best adventure bike under $6,500 on the market. If budget matters and you want to explore with an honest, well-equipped bike, you will struggle to find a better proposition.
